Building Services 32BJ Benefit Funds (“the Funds”) is the umbrella organization responsible for administering Health, Pension, Retirement Savings, Training, and Legal Services benefits to over 185,000 SEIU 32BJ members. The Funds oversees and manages $11 billion of dollars in assets, which are made up of many, varied and complex funds. The dollars come from a number of sources, including the property owners who pay into the funds on behalf of their employees, and as such, requires those who oversee and manage the money to be highly skilled financial management people. 32BJ Benefit Funds will continue to drive innovation, equity, and technology insights to further help the lives of our hard-working members and their families. Responsibilities

  • Coordinate the timely onboarding of employers onto electronic reporting
  • Communicate daily with employers using Electronic Reporting
  • Report, track, and resolve all technical and data issues, including the maintenance of all electronic reporting systems
  • Assist department manager with all critical issues that are assigned to Employer Relations
  • Participate in and manage project work assigned to the department
  • Act as a lead within the department and assist with training staff as required
  • Coordinate and make presentations to employers
  • Calculate remittance obligations and explain to employers
  • Follow the workflow and processes of Fund operations as they relate to employers (Billing, Audit, Collections, Eligibility, and Contracts)
  • Implement a comprehensive communications plan that provides timely information to employers about Trustees goals, and Funds initiative, actions and other valuable news, using multiple channels to deliver this information
  • Implement external communications initiatives in a manner that maximizes use of all forms of communications, including and not limited employer advisories, employer meetings and presentations, employer broadcast and internet website
  • Conduct educational seminars and workshops on and off site with employer groups
  • Able to build relationships with a broad range of people
  • Draft letters, memorandums, and educational materials
  • Able to work as part of a team whether inter and/or intra departmental; as well as take a leadership role
  • Perform additional duties as directed by the Director, Employer Relations
